Basic Concepts of Cam Followers

Cam followers are mechanical components that ride along a cam, translating rotational motion into linear motion. Within an engine, cam followers play a role in the operation of the valve train, ensuring that valves open and close at the correct times. They are integral to the mechanical systems of engines, providing the necessary motion and precision for optimal engine function 1.

Role of the 4068612 Cam Follower in Truck Operation

The Cummins 4068612 Cam Follower is specifically designed to interact with the camshaft in a truck engine. It plays a role in the valve train system by following the contour of the camshaft and transferring motion to the valves. This interaction ensures that the valves open and close in sync with the engine’s operation, contributing to efficient combustion and overall engine performance.

Cummins Engine Compatibility with Part 4068612

The Cummins Cam Follower part number 4068612 is designed to fit seamlessly into several engine models, ensuring optimal performance and longevity. This part is integral to the engine’s operation, providing essential support and reducing wear on critical components.

QST30 CM2350 T101 and QST30 CM552

The Cam Follower part 4068612 is compatible with both the QST30 CM2350 T101 and the QST30 CM552 engines. These engines are part of the Cummins QST30 series, which is known for its reliability and efficiency in various applications. The Cam Follower’s design ensures it fits perfectly within the engine’s architecture, maintaining the necessary clearance and alignment with the camshaft. This compatibility is crucial for the smooth operation of the engine, as it directly affects the valve train’s performance.
